Jacki Abrams is a scholar working on Surgery, Reproductive Medicine and Rheumatology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jacki Abrams has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 771 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Surgery, 10 papers in Reproductive Medicine and 6 papers in Rheumatology. Recurrent topics in Jacki Abrams's work include Sperm and Testicular Function (6 papers), Urologic and reproductive health conditions (6 papers) and Testicular diseases and treatments (4 papers). Jacki Abrams is often cited by papers focused on Sperm and Testicular Function (6 papers), Urologic and reproductive health conditions (6 papers) and Testicular diseases and treatments (4 papers). Jacki Abrams coll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Canada. Jacki Abrams's co-authors include Anwar Farhood, Russell Vang, James A. Talcott, Edward D. Kim, Larry I. Lipshultz, Deepali Gupta, William W. Lin, Lavinia P. Middleton, Joseph M. Corson and Diljeet K. Singh and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Urology, Fertility and Sterility and The American Journal of Surgical Pathology.
